While innovation makes daily life easier, it also plays a crucial role in saving lives through advancements in medicine. As human life expectancy has increased, many doctors have dreamed of diagnosing diseases before their symptoms become apparent. Using just one drop of urine for this purpose is revolutionary because it is non-invasive, easy to use, and allows healthcare professionals to provide timely treatment.
Urine contains more than 3,000 substances that can provide insights into how the body functions. In 2022, a study from Turkey published in Scientific Reports showed that using specialized tools like FTIR( a type of spectrometric analysis) can detect abnormalities in individuals with health conditions. This method can help diagnose diseases such as diabetes, kidney problems, autism, and even some cancers. Additionally, this approach is ideal for people who are afraid of needles, making health tests more accessible for everyone. This innovation is not just beneficial for individuals— it has the potential to transform public health.
Scientists are still working to improve the accuracy and expand the applications of this technology. They aim to make it effective for diagnosing a wider range of diseases. Even now, diagnosing diseases with just a drop of urine represents a significant and exciting step forward in healthcare.
